Download Important Update KB971029 To Disable Autorun In Autoplay For Windows XP, Server 2003 And Vista



Microsoft has released an important update for Windows XP, Windows Server 2003 and Windows Vista yesterday, users are adviced to install this update due to security enhancement.

The update was KB971029 , which will fix a problem with the disable Autorun feature. Without these updates, Autorun for a network drive cannot be disabled. Also, the shortcut menu and double-click functionality of Autorun were not disabled even if the various steps on tweaking been done.

AutoPlay is a function that begins reading from a drive as soon as you insert media into the drive. Therefore, the setup file of programs and the music on audio media start immediately.

Autorun commands are generally stored in Autorun.inf files. These commands enable applications to start, start installation programs, or start other routines. In versions of Windows that are earlier than Windows Vista, when media that contains an Autorun command is inserted, the system automatically executes the program without requiring user intervention. Because code may be executed without user's knowledge or consent, users may want to disable this feature because of security concerns.

In Windows 7, it's already comes with this enhancement in Autorun feature which restricts the Autorun entry to only CD and DVD drives. It helps in keeping your system safe from malware executions, etc.
